CACHING MULTIPLE VIEWS CORRESPONDING TO MULTIPLE ASPECT RATIOS
First Claim
1. A method comprising:
- presenting a targeted application in a first configuration within a primary application in a first presentation format, the first configuration being adapted for the first presentation format, andstoring multiple configurations of the targeted application including the displayed first configuration, the configurations for presentation within the primary application being in multiple presentation formats.
1 Assignment
0 Petitions
Accused Products
Abstract
The present technology presents targeted content, such as a targeted application, in multiple different configurations to correspond to multiple display orientations. In one example, a primary application having a view reserved to present the targeted application is configured to be presented in either a landscape or a portrait presentation format depending on the orientation of the display. The primary application is further configured to switch from either the landscape or portrait presentation format to the other presentation format when the orientation of the display is changed. Accordingly, the targeted application can be downloaded in multiple configurations so that the configuration that is appropriate for the displayed presentation format of the primary application can be presented with the reserved view.
43 Citations
27 Claims
-
1. A method comprising:
-
presenting a targeted application in a first configuration within a primary application in a first presentation format, the first configuration being adapted for the first presentation format, and storing multiple configurations of the targeted application including the displayed first configuration, the configurations for presentation within the primary application being in multiple presentation formats.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15)
-
-
16. A product comprising:
-
a non-transitory machine-readable medium; and machine-executable instructions stored on the machine-readable medium for causing a computer to perform the method comprising; receiving metadata from an application server describing a targeted application for display within a primary application; downloading the targeted application in multiple configurations correlated to multiple presentation formats of the primary application; and displaying the targeted application in the configuration that correlates to the displayed presentation format of the primary application. - View Dependent Claims (17, 18, 19, 20, 21)
-
-
22. A system for presenting targeted content in multiple configurations comprising:
-
a communications interface configured to request from an applications server a targeted application having multiple configurations for fitting specified aspect ratios; the applications server configured to receive the request for the targeted information and to return a targeted application having multiple configurations that fit the specified aspect ratios; the communications interface further configured to receive the targeted application from the applications server; and a processor configured to present the targeted application for display within a primary application, the targeted application being in the configuration that matches the aspect ratio of a view reserved for presenting the targeted application. - View Dependent Claims (23, 24, 25, 26, 27)
-
Specification